Ordinals
beta
Address bc1qt5v0pj4h6uadvfrw527226rune5nqlh3nr5d9q
sat balance
3005460
outputs
77a637dddd5d1cfb9ce3163851e0941c9af3abb9394cb560678ac0cd093d7283:36
c3a65c997820de2e9e4d89ee9f766bf2a32b19b620d3d7b146457fa59dc399e1:1